Find the Right Business Coach: Executive Coach for a Small Business
Step 1: Identify Your Needs
The first step in partnering with the right business coach is identifying your needs. What are the areas of your business that require the most support? Do you need help developing a business plan, marketing, or managing finances? Once you have pinpointed the areas that require the most attention, you can search for a business coach who specializes in those areas.
It is also essential to consider your budget when identifying your needs. Business coaches can vary in price, so determine how much you’re willing to spend before reaching out to potential coaches. Remember that hiring a business coach is an investment in your business, and finding the right coach to provide you with the support you need within your budget is essential.
Step 2: Research Potential Coaches
Once you have identified your needs, the next step is to research potential business coaches. There are many ways to find a business coach, including online searches, referrals, and networking events. When researching potential coaches, it is essential to consider their experience, credentials, and reputation. Look for coaches who have experience handling commercial finance with a track record of success.
When researching potential coaches, it is also essential to consider their coaching style. Some coaches take a hands-on approach, while others provide more guidance and support from a distance. Finding a coach whose coaching style aligns with your preferences and needs is essential.
Step 3: Meet with Potential Coaches
The final step in partnering with the right business coach is to meet with potential coaches. Depending on your location and the coach’s availability, this meeting can occur in person or virtually. In this meeting, you can ask questions to get to know the coach better. Do come prepared with a list of questions like:
- What experience do you have working with businesses like mine?
- What is your coaching style?
- What are your fees?
- How do you measure success?
- What is your availability?
Paying attention to the coach’s communication style during this meeting is also essential. A business coach should be someone you feel comfortable communicating with and can provide you with the guidance and support you need.
